The eyes of darkness
by Dean Koontz

Tina Evans dreams that her son Danny is still alive. And when she wakes, she finds a message scrawled on Danny's chalkboard: not dead. Tina searches for the truth and learns that there are some things worse than death. Includes a new Afterword by the author.

The Eyes of Darkness
First published in 1981
Subjects
Mothers and sons, Fiction, HorrorWork Description
A mother sends her son on a camping trip with a leader who has led this trip into the mountains 16 times before without mishap; that is until this time. Every single camper and leader and driver die with no explanation. As the grieving mother who is the protagonist begins to accept the fact that her son, Danny, is dead she starts getting vicious bully-like attacks from nowhere saying he is not dead, such as writing on chalk boards, words from printers and other various 'signs'. Along with her new friend, Elliot Stryker, Christina Evans sets out to find out what could have possibly happened on the day that her son 'died'.

Edition Notes
Originally published under the pseudonym Leigh Nichols.
